3. Winchester Hospital was named No. 4 in the large employer category on the BostonGlobe’s 100 Top Places to Work 2012. Winchester Hospital – which earned the No. 1, No. 2, No. 5 and No. 4 rankings in the Globe’s last four listings of top employers in Massachusetts, respectively – was this year’s highest ranked hospital.
